Surge protection for photovoltaic (PV) installations is a critical component in safeguarding your solar energy investment against transient overvoltages caused by lightning strikes or switching operations. These devices, often referred to as Type 1, Type 2, or Type 1+2 surge arresters, are designed to limit surge voltages and divert surge currents to ground, protecting inverters, panels, and other sensitive equipment. Key technical parameters include maximum continuous operating voltage (Uc), nominal discharge current (In), and maximum discharge current (Imax), typically rated for DC systems up to 1500V. OBO BETTERMANN offers a comprehensive range of PV-specific surge protection devices (SPDs) with robust enclosures rated IP65 or higher, ensuring reliable performance in outdoor environments.

These surge protectors are primarily installed in photovoltaic systems, including rooftop and ground-mounted solar arrays, solar farms, and building-integrated photovoltaics (BIPV). They are essential in DC combiner boxes, inverter DC inputs, and AC distribution boards downstream of the inverter. The devices are also used in industrial and commercial facilities with large-scale PV generation, as well as residential solar installations, to comply with international standards like IEC 61643-31 and EN 50539-11.

The main subcategories include Type 1 (Class I) surge arresters for direct lightning protection, Type 2 (Class II) for switching surge protection, and combined Type 1+2 devices.
